What is the purpose of a Form 6-K filing?

A Form 6-K filing is a report of a foreign private issuer pursuant to Rule 13a-16 or 15d-16 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, used to provide information that the registrant has made or is required to make public pursuant to the laws of its home country, or has filed or will file with any stock exchange on which its securities are traded.

TEEKAY CORPORATION Date August 1, 2024 By s Brody Speers Brody Speers Vice President, Finance Treasurer (Principal Financial and Accounting Officer) Teekay Corporation Investor Relations Tel +1 604 609 2963 www.teekay.com 4 th Floor, Belvedere Building, 69 Pitts Bay Road, Hamilton, HM 08, Bermuda TEEKAY CORPORATION REPORTS SECOND QUARTER 2024 RESULTS Highlights GAAP net income attributable to shareholders of Teekay of $33.8 million, or $0.36 per share, and adjusted net income attributable to shareholders of Teekay (2) of $33.2 million, or $0.36 per share, in the second quarter of 2024 (excluding items listed in Appendix A to this release). Tanker market remains firm, with Teekay Tankers securing third quarter 2024 to-date average spot rates of $40,800 per day for its Suezmax fleet and $45,300 per day for its Aframax fleet, respectively. In May 2024, Teekay Tankers agreed to sell two 2005-built vessels for combined gross proceeds of $64.8 million. In addition, in July 2024, Teekay Tankers completed the acquisition of a 2021-built Aframax tanker for $70.5 million. In line with Teekay Tankers' fixed dividend policy, Teekay Tankers decl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.25 per common share for the quarter ended June 30, 2024. Hamilton, Bermuda, August 1, 2024 - Teekay Corporation ( Teekay or the Company ) (NYSETK) today reported results for the three months ended June 30, 2024. These results include the Company's publicly-listed consolidated subsidiary, Teekay Tankers Ltd. ( Teekay Tankers ) (NYSETNK), and all remaining subsidiaries and equity-accounted investments.
